Description: Stirplate.io Data Upload Helper
        ===============================
        
        Sequencing data may be sent to Stirplate several ways.
        
        1. Manual data upload via `stirplate.io <https://stirplate.io>`__.
        2. **RECOMMENDED**: Automatic upload from a local computer directly to
           Stirplate without user interaction (outlined in this document).
        
        Installation:
        --------------
        
        -  To setup and run automated data upload to Stirplate, be sure you have
           your Stirplate User Credentials (please contact keith@stirplate.io to
           obtain these).
        -  Python 2.7.x (untested on Python >= 3).
        -  ::
        
              pip install stirplate
        
        -  A ``stirplate`` executable will be added to your system path.
        
        
        Configure Access:
        -----------------
        
        Configure your Stirplate Access Credentials.
        
        1. **Interactive**: Simply type:
        
           ::
        
              stirplate configure
        
        2. **Automatic**: (Recommended) "Install" the supplied configuration
           file automatically from a downloaded config file:
        
           ::
        
              stirplate configure --install /path/to/stirplate/config
        
        RNA-Seq protocol:
        ------------------------------------------------------
        
        There are two ways to run the data upload helper for the Stirplate
        RNA-Seq (DESeq2) protocol:
        
        1. **Interactive**. Simply type:
        
           ::
        
              stirplate rna
        
           -  You will be prompted for the input directory containing your
              sequencing data, as well as additional meta data (aligner [TopHat, STAR], species, single
              stranded protocol) information.
        
        2. **Automatic**. Simply run:
        
           ::
        
               stirplate rna
               --aligner star
               --directory /path/to/input/sequencing/data/
               --project_name MyProjectName
               --species SPECIES
        
        
           -  Aliger choices are: ``tophat`` (default), and ``star``.
           -  Species choices are: ``C_ELEGANS`` (worms), ``D_RERIO``
              (zebrafish), ``H_SAPIENS`` (humans), ``M_MUSCULUS`` (mouse),
              ``R_NORVEGICUS`` (rat), ``B_TAURUS`` (cow), ``C_FAMILIARIS`` (dog), or ``E_CABALLUS`` (horse).
           -  If the experiment was performed using a single strand protocol,
              pass the ``--single_stranded_protocol`` flag as well.
           -  Upon running, all files in your input sequence data ``directory``
              will be uploaded to Stirplate.io. The uploading is optimized for
              speed so your data will be transferred in the least amount of
              time. **Processing will begin at Stirplate as soon as the last
              file transfer has completed**.
        
        DNA-Seq protocol:
        ------------------------------------------------------
        
        There are two ways to run the data upload helper for the Stirplate
        RNA-Seq (DESeq2) protocol:
        
        1. **Interactive**. Simply type:
        
           ::
        
              stirplate dna
        
           -  You will be prompted for the input directory containing your
              sequencing data, as well as additional meta data (aligner [TopHat, STAR], species, single
              stranded protocol) information.
        
        2. **Automatic**. Simply run:
        
           ::
        
               stirplate dna
               --directory /path/to/input/sequencing/data/
               --interval_file /path/to/input/sequencing/data/intervals.interval_list
               --project_name MyProjectName
               --species SPECIES
        
        
           -  Species choices are currently:  ``H_SAPIENS`` (humans). More available on request. Email keith@stirplate.io.
           -  Upon running, all files in your input sequence data ``directory``
              will be uploaded to Stirplate.io. The uploading is optimized for
              speed so your data will be transferred in the least amount of
              time. **Processing will begin at Stirplate as soon as the last
              file transfer has completed**.
        
        Help
        ----
        
        At any point you may get additional command line usage help by typing:
        
        -  ``stirplate -h``
        -  ``stirplate rna -h``
        -  ``stirplate dna -h``
